AI-driven visual intelligence refers to the use of machine learning and computer vision technologies to analyze and interpret visual data. By applying these advanced systems, painters can assess large volumes of neighborhood imagery—think drone footage, Google Street View images, social media photos, and more—to discern prevailing color palettes, emerging trends, and design preferences specific to different areas. This precise data provides painters with the context needed to tailor their services, not only fulfilling current demands but also proposing innovative solutions that align with or even set new trends.
Consider the various advantages: by knowing the prevalent colors within a neighborhood, painters can better propose cohesive designs that enhance curb appeal, suggesting accent walls that harmonize with the street’s aesthetic or new color schemes that might elevate property values.
